Output 85251d4f8bbecaf4ae61e3a0d1700a24933ef0c298d5a119a4a9fdbdb6554e70:0

value
2095375
script pubkey
OP_HASH160 OP_PUSHBYTES_20 caa73e82bde941c2c93f6913fc6f8df94fd0c871 OP_EQUAL
address
3LAYmd65BkjaN4LipwLM27cxj3tBqpTDAw
transaction
85251d4f8bbecaf4ae61e3a0d1700a24933ef0c298d5a119a4a9fdbdb6554e70
confirmations
189631
spent
true